Does artificial putting-green turf drain properly in Buckhead's clay soil?

Yes, provided it's installed correctly. We remove compacted clay to proper depth, install a permeable base layer, and use infill systems that allow water to percolate through rather than sitting on top. The key difference from DIY or budget installations is proper sub-base engineering. Buckhead's clay actually becomes an advantage when you have a professional drainage plan—the clay sits beneath, and the turf system above handles its own drainage independently.

How long does artificial putting-green turf last?

Quality systems we install typically perform beautifully for 15+ years with minimal maintenance. In Buckhead's climate, where UV exposure and occasional heavy rain are the main stressors, premium turf holds up exceptionally well. You're looking at occasional infill raking and perhaps a cleaning every few years—nothing compared to the mowing, watering, and soil amendments required for natural greens in Georgia's clay.
